  1. The Walking Hills (1949) Mark Franklin June 18, 2016 1940s. A modern Western, set near the border of Mexico. A card game turns into a gold hunt when one of the players mentions that his horse tripped on a wagon wheel crossing the desert. One hundred years earlier, a small wagon train carrying $5 million in gold got lost in that same desert.
